DSPIC33FJ32GP302-I/SO Microchip Technology, DSPIC33FJ32GP302-I/SO Datasheet - Page 265

IC DSPIC MCU/DSP 32K 28SOIC

DSPIC33FJ32GP302-I/SO

Manufacturer Part Number
DSPIC33FJ32GP302-I/SO
Description
IC DSPIC MCU/DSP 32K 28SOIC
Manufacturer
Microchip Technology
Series
dsPIC™ 33Fr

Specifications of DSPIC33FJ32GP302-I/SO

Program Memory Type
FLASH
Program Memory Size
32KB (32K x 8)
Package / Case
28-SOIC (7.5mm Width)
Core Processor
dsPIC
Core Size
16-Bit
Speed
40 MIPs
Connectivity
I²C, IrDA, LIN, SPI, UART/USART
Peripherals
AC'97, Brown-out Detect/Reset, DMA, I²S, POR, PWM, WDT
Number Of I /o
21
Ram Size
4K x 8
Voltage - Supply (vcc/vdd)
3 V ~ 3.6 V
Data Converters
A/D 10x10b/12b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 85°C
Product
DSCs
Data Bus Width
16 bit
Processor Series
DSPIC33F
Core
dsPIC
Maximum Clock Frequency
40 MHz
Number Of Programmable I/os
21
Data Ram Size
4 KB
Maximum Operating Temperature
+ 85 C
Mounting Style
SMD/SMT
3rd Party Development Tools
52713-733, 52714-737, 53276-922, EWDSPIC
Development Tools By Supplier
PG164130, DV164035, DV244005, DV164005, PG164120, DM240001, DV164033
Minimum Operating Temperature
- 40 C
Package
28SOIC W
Device Core
dsPIC
Family Name
dsPIC33
Maximum Speed
40 MHz
Operating Supply Voltage
3.3 V
Interface Type
I2C/SPI/UART
On-chip Adc
10-chx10-bit|10-chx12-bit
Number Of Timers
3
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
For Use With
DV164033 - KIT START EXPLORER 16 MPLAB ICD2DM240001 - BOARD DEMO PIC24/DSPIC33/PIC32
Eeprom Size
-
Lead Free Status / Rohs Status
Lead free / RoHS Compliant
Reset
Reset Sequence ................................................................. 71
Resets ................................................................................. 63
S
Serial Peripheral Interface (SPI) ....................................... 149
Software Reset Instruction (SWR) ...................................... 69
Software Simulator (MPLAB SIM)..................................... 201
Software Stack Pointer, Frame Pointer
Special Features of the CPU ............................................ 183
SPI Module
Symbols Used in Opcode Descriptions............................. 192
System Control
T
Temperature and Voltage Specifications
Timer1 ............................................................................... 135
Timer2/3, Timer4/5, Timer6/7 and Timer8/9 ..................... 137
Timing Characteristics
Timing Diagrams
 2009 Microchip Technology Inc.
OSCCON (Oscillator Control) ................................... 102
OSCTUN (FRC Oscillator Tuning) ............................ 106
PLLFBD (PLL Feedback Divisor).............................. 105
PMD1 (Peripheral Module Disable Control Register 1) ..
PMD2 (Peripheral Module Disable Control Register 2) ..
RCON (Reset Control) ................................................ 64
SPIxCON1 (SPIx Control 1)...................................... 151
SPIxCON2 (SPIx Control 2)...................................... 153
SPIxSTAT (SPIx Status and Control) ....................... 150
SR (CPU Status)................................................... 22, 76
T1CON (Timer1 Control)........................................... 136
TxCON (T2CON, T4CON, T6CON or T8CON Control) ..
TyCON (T3CON, T5CON, T7CON or T9CON Control) ..
UxMODE (UARTx Mode).......................................... 164
UxSTA (UARTx Status and Control)......................... 166
Illegal Opcode ....................................................... 63, 70
Trap Conflict.......................................................... 69, 70
Uninitialized W Register........................................ 63, 70
CALL Stack Frame...................................................... 47
SPI1 Register Map...................................................... 40
Register Map............................................................... 46
AC ..................................................................... 212, 240
CLKO and I/O ........................................................... 215
10-bit A/D Conversion............................................... 235
10-bit A/D Conversion (CHPS = 01, SIMSAM = 0, ASAM
12-bit A/D Conversion (ASAM = 0, SSRC = 000) ..... 234
Brown-out Situations................................................... 69
External Clock........................................................... 213
I2Cx Bus Data (Master Mode) .................................. 227
I2Cx Bus Data (Slave Mode) .................................... 229
I2Cx Bus Start/Stop Bits (Master Mode) ................... 227
I2Cx Bus Start/Stop Bits (Slave Mode) ..................... 229
Input Capture (CAPx)................................................ 220
OC/PWM................................................................... 221
Output Compare (OCx)............................................. 220
Reset, Watchdog Timer, Oscillator Start-up Timer and
SPIx Master Mode (CKE = 0) ................................... 222
SPIx Master Mode (CKE = 1) ................................... 223
SPIx Slave Mode (CKE = 0) ..................................... 224
SPIx Slave Mode (CKE = 1) ..................................... 225
111
112
140
141
= 0, SSRC = 000) ............................................. 235
Power-up Timer ................................................ 216
dsPIC33FJ32GP202/204 and dsPIC33FJ16GP304
Preliminary
Timing Requirements
Timing Specifications
U
UART Module
Using the RCON Status Bits............................................... 70
V
Voltage Regulator (On-Chip) ............................................ 186
W
Watchdog Time-out Reset (WDTR).................................... 69
Watchdog Timer (WDT)............................................ 183, 187
WWW Address ................................................................. 267
WWW, On-Line Support ....................................................... 9
Timer1, 2, 3, 4, 5, 6, 7, 8, 9 External Clock .............. 218
ADC Conversion (10-bit mode) ................................ 245
ADC Conversion (12-bit Mode) ................................ 245
CLKO and I/O ........................................................... 215
External Clock .......................................................... 213
Input Capture............................................................ 220
SPIx Master Mode (CKE = 0) ................................... 241
SPIx Module Master Mode (CKE = 1) ...................... 241
SPIx Module Slave Mode (CKE = 0) ........................ 242
SPIx Module Slave Mode (CKE = 1) ........................ 242
10-bit A/D Conversion Requirements ....................... 236
12-bit A/D Conversion Requirements ....................... 234
I2Cx Bus Data Requirements (Master Mode)........... 228
I2Cx Bus Data Requirements (Slave Mode)............. 230
Output Compare Requirements................................ 220
PLL Clock ......................................................... 214, 240
Reset, Watchdog Timer, Oscillator Start-up Timer, Pow-
Simple OC/PWM Mode Requirements ..................... 221
SPIx Master Mode (CKE = 0) Requirements............ 222
SPIx Master Mode (CKE = 1) Requirements............ 223
SPIx Slave Mode (CKE = 0) Requirements.............. 224
SPIx Slave Mode (CKE = 1) Requirements.............. 226
Timer1 External Clock Requirements ....................... 218
Timer2, Timer4, Timer6 and Timer8 External Clock Re-
Timer3, Timer5, Timer7 and Timer9 External Clock Re-
UART1 Register Map ................................................. 40
Programming Considerations ................................... 187
er-up Timer and Brown-out Reset Requirements...
217
quirements........................................................ 219
quirements........................................................ 219
DS70290F-page 265

Related parts for DSPIC33FJ32GP302-I/SO